Yankees, Granderson Beat Twins 7-6
The Twins lost 7-6 at New York to the Yankees Thursday night. Curtis Granderson hit 3 homeruns for the Yankees. 2 of Granderson's homeruns came against Twins starter Anthony Swarzak. Swarzak allowed 8 hits and 6 earned runs in 2 2/3 innings to take the loss and drop to 0-3. Ryan Doumit went 2-4 with a 2-run homerun and 4 RBIs and Danny Valencia went 2-4 with 2 RBIs for the Twins.
Glen Perkins returned to the mound Thursday night and threw a scoreless 8th inning. He had missed time with a sore forearm. The Twins were trying to win a series in New York for the first time since 2001. Minnesota settled for a split in the 4-game series.
